Highly efficient, recyclable Pd(II) catalysts with bisimidazole ligands for the heck reaction in ionic liquids

[GRAPHICS] New Pd(II) complexes with bisimidazole ligands were prepared and proved to be effective catalysts for the Heck reaction under phosphine-free conditions using ionic liquids as solvents. This system could be recycled five times without any loss of catalytic activity.
